Grade 5 Geometry
Angles and Polygons; Terms
Question | Answer |
---|---|
Point | Exact position or location on a plane or line |
Line | No beginning or end point |
Ray | Straight line that begins at a certain point and extends forever in one direction |
Line Segment | A part of a straight line that does not extend forever but has two distinct endpoints |
Right angle | Exactly 90 degrees |
Acute angle | Less than 90 degrees |
Obtuse angle | Between 90 and 180 degrees |
Straight angle | Exactly 180 degrees |
Vertical angles | Opposite angles formed by the intersection of two lines |
Congruent angles | Angles with the same measure |
Complementary angles | Sum of angles is 90 degrees |
Supplementary angles | Sum of angles is 180 degrees |
Acute triangle | A triangle that has all acute angles |
Right triangle | A triangle that has one right angle |
Obtuse triangle | A triangle that has one obtuse angle |
Scalene triangle | A triangle with no congruent sides |
Isosceles triangle | A triangle with at least 2 congruent sides |
Equilateral triangle | A triangle with all sides congruent |
Quadrilateral | A figure with four sides and four angles |
Similar figures | Figures that have the same shape but not the same size |
Congruent figures | Figures that have the same size and shape |
